Brenda Judith García Valadez (born 12 February 1996) is a Mexican footballer who plays as a defender. She most recently played for Liga MX Femenil club Mazatlán.[2]

Brenda García was born on 12 February 1996 in Aguascalientes City.[3]

She made her professional debut for Necaxa on 3 May 2017 in a game against Santos Laguna, where she scored Necaxa's first goal ever four minutes into the match.[4] García scored her second goal with Necaxa in the Apertura 2017 tournament in a 1–1 draw with Atlas.[5]

For the 2019–20 season, García was transferred to Cruz Azul, where she has become a fundamental player for the team.[6]

On 10 April 2025, the Mexican Football Federation (FMF) launched an investigation for match fixing involving Mazatlán players in which García took part.[7][8] On 30 April, she was banned by the FMF for six years for match fixing and released by Mazatlán on 9 May.[9][10]
